Etc/github

git rm --cached <filename>

IT grow. 2019. 3. 3. 02:00
반응형

생각없이 git으로 폴더 올리다가 다음과 같은 것을 보았다.


보면 새로운 파일이 있다고 한다 . 


이것을 무시하고 git push를 하게 되면 오류가난다.


찾아보니까 , 내가 예전에 github remote에 push를 했었던 기억이 난다 . 

그렇지만 , 그파일은 잘못올린 파일이였고 , 무시하고 할려니까 안됬다.


해결 방법은 간단하다 .


두 가지 방법이 있다 .


git rm [filename]

--> 원격 저장소와 로컬 저장소에 있는 파일을 삭제

git rm --cached [filename]

--> 원격 저장소에 있는 파일만 삭제

git rm --cached "삭제할 주소"/\*.파일형태

 --> 삭제할 주소하위에 파일형태만 지운다.


다음과 같이 삭제할 수 있다.


반응형